We’re Hiring | Cluster Finance Controller
An exceptional career opportunity for a senior hospitality finance leader to join two ultra-luxury resort hotels in Sardinia in a cluster leadership role.
We are seeking a strategic, commercially minded Cluster Finance Controller to lead financial operations, controls, and business performance across two flagship luxury properties.
- Primary Responsibilities
Financial Control:
-
- overseeing all sales, purchasing, salaries and expenses
- Implementing and reviewing Financial policies
- Audit compliance including actioning recommendations and liaising with internal stakeholders
Financial Reporting:
-
- Production of monthly financial reporting GAAP
- Overseeing budgeting & forecasting process and long term planning
- Monthly and annual reporting
Financial Performance:
-
- Responsible for monitoring budgets and for reporting major deviations of over-expenditure, under-budgeting or non-compliance to the approved budget
- Business partner with two General Managers implementing controls, solutions, and action plans
- Assist the General Managers in establishing local policies, rules, internal controls and safeguards that ensure profitability and control of operations
- Advise and provide counsel to the General Managers, HODs and finance teams on all financial matters
- Treasury & Tax
- Treasury management, cash planning, reviewieng the cash position in order to optimize the use of funds and minimize the volume of cash being held in the business
- Review all changes of tax laws and accounting policies, assess their implications on the business and ensure the finance team implements appropriate changes
- Other
- Support the financial function of any opening of new products.
- Assist with the accounting related to any hotel or other asset sales, product closure and ownership changes
- Together with the General Managers, manage the relations with third party, owners and/or partners
- Facilitate the best communication and reporting between the Belmond regional office in Milan and the Cheval Blanc corporate offices in Paris
- Communicate relevant information to the Divisional Financial Controllers and the General Managers,
Requirements
- Proven experience as Director of Finance / Financial Controller in luxury or ultra-luxury hotels or resorts
- Strong cluster / multi-property exposure preferred
- Solid leadership skills with commercial mindset and hands-on approach
- Fluent in English and Italian
Benefits
- Permanent contract according to C.C.N.L. Settore Turismo (Confindustria)
- Bonus
- Accommodation
- Company car
